Ethylhexyl Methoxycrylene

Rating: Good

Benefits: Anti-Aging,

Categories: Texture Enhancer, Solvent, UV Filters,

Ethylhexyl Methoxycrylene at a Glance

  • UV absorber and stabilizing ingredient for sunscreen actives
  • Also helps stabilize antioxidants such as vitamin A (retinol)
  • Can be used as a solvent to enhance formulary texture, leading to more pleasing aesthetics.
  • Viscous yellow liquid in raw material form

Ethylhexyl Methoxycrylene Description

The research for ethylhexyl methoxycrylene mainly focuses on its effectiveness as a UV absorber and stabilizing ingredient for sunscreen actives. Because it enhances UV protection, ethylhexyl methoxycrylene can be considered an anti-aging ingredient.

Similarly, studies show ethylhexyl methoxycrylene in amounts between 4–5% helps stabilize formulas containing vitamin A ingredients, as well as other antioxidants such as trans-resveratrol and ubiquinone.

Another function of ethylhexyl methoxycrylene is that it can be used as a solvent to enhance formulary texture, leading to more pleasing aesthetics.

Suppliers of this ingredient describe it as a viscous yellow liquid in its raw material form.
